This is a combination pack of two single homeopathic remedies, Thuja Occidentalis and Antimonium Crudum, distributed by Rxhomeo for symptomatic relief from warts. Thuja Occidentalis is used for warts on any part of the body, while Antimonium Crudum is used for warts and corns, as well as sensitive feet and skin eruptions. The product should be taken orally by allowing the pellets or tablets to dissolve on tongue, at least three times a day, 30 minutes before or after food. The adult dose is 4-5 pellets or tablets, and children should take half of the adult dose. The product should be kept in a cool, dark place, and the cap should be closed tightly after use. If symptoms do not improve or worsen, professional advice should be sought.*
